Vince Sr. has the benefit of rose tinted glasses in hindsight and the people who utterly hated Vince Jr. comparing the two. Bruno praised Vince Sr. over Vince Jr. but also had more then several issues with Vince Sr. Vince senior screwed him out of pay and then double booked him to get him suspended by the athletic commission. You can say his corruption wasn' as bad but it was a different flavor then Vince's and each was a product of his time and much of the bad stuff they did was to grow their businesses at the cost of other people. You can't even make that argument for Dixie.
